Bio:Cynthia (Cindy) Mitchell is of counsel with the law firm of Merkel & Cocke, P.A. Ms. Mitchell received her Bachelor of Arts degree from Indiana University in 1981, graduating magna cum laude and Phi Beta Kappa, with an Honors Degree. She received her J.D. from Harvard University Law School in 1981, graduating cum laude.Ms. Mitchell’s practice includes general litigation, personal injury, commercial litigation, and medical malpractice. She has handled numerous and varied appellate cases. She was a member of the litigation team representing Bob Wilson and Alwyn Luckey against Richard Scruggs of the Fall of the House of Zeus fame.Ms. Mitchell is admitted to practice before all state courts in Mississippi, the United States Supreme Court, the U.S. District Courts for the Northern and Southern Districts of Mississippi, the Eastern and Western Districts of Arkansas, the Western District of Tennessee, and the Fifth and Eighth Circuit Court of Appeals.Ms. Mitchell is a member of the Mississippi State Bar Association, Mississippi Association for Justice (President 2016-17; Vice President 2015-16; Treasurer 2014-15; Secretary, 2012-13; Parliamentarian 2011-12), American Association of Justice, and the Coahoma County Bar Association (President, 1990-91). She currently serves on the Rules Advisory Committee to the Mississippi Supreme Court and as a Fellow of the Mississippi Bar Foundation. Mitchell offers free consultation, (if not) how much the initial interview costs, if there is any hidden attorney fees, what's the fee schedule, whether he or she has good community reputation and is able to provide a list of good references. You can also contact the Board of Professional Responsibility of the state bar, to find out if Cynthia I. Mitchell has ever been placed under any disciplinary actions. Please be aware that, though Cynthia I. Mitchell's office is located at Clarksdale, MS, he or she might belong to the bar association of other states.

You should also ask how long the lawyer has been in practice, how much experience he or she has in cases like yours, and more importantly, the outcomes of those cases! Focus of the lawyer's practice and years of experience are also very important factors in your evaluation process. The more focused the lawyer's practice areas, the better service he or she could provide. So do not make decisions solely on one or two factors. Only hire lawyers you feel comfortable with as they will represent you and your interests, and you will be sharing private details about your life with them.
